I feel compelled to post this as prior to me purchasing from Jeremiah (garagearcadecom) I saw a few posts that made me hesitant (bad seller, poor packing).

However, I did purchase anyway, as I was interested in the VS mother board with Mario Bros and Golf for my Red Tent.

1. Items were very well packed and I received them in a timely manner
2. One of the games was not working (Mario Bros)
3. Jeremiah responded right away (after I had taken over a week to test it) and sent me a new chip set
4. Second chipset did not work either and through some testing I discovered that the issue was with the CPU chip
5. Jeremiah accepted my testing results and then immediatley sent out a new (correct) CPU
6. This CPU worked and I am very happy

Through the couple or so weeks of shipping and me getting around to testing, Jeremiah worked with me and communicated promptly to help resolve.

Additionally, when I enquired about how much he would charge me to keep the incorrect CPU (you never know when you'll need it!), as I promised to mail back the extra Mario Bros chip set, he said to keep it for free.

I cannot speak for other's experience but I can say that through respectful communications mine was great and would not hestiate again to order from him again.

As people only tend to offer feedback when an experience is bad, I felt that my experience was so good that it would only seem fair to take 5 minutes to call that out as well.
